Outdoor Learning - Anderson Shelter Building
Today's outdoor learning was linked to our World War 2 topic. We looked at different images of Anderson Shelters before beginning to work in small teams to build our own. We had planks of wood and cardboard. In our teams, we had to think carefully about how to make it secure. Unfortunately, one of our groups lost the roof of theirs, so they had to rethink, redesign and modify their plans. By the end of the session, all of us had a secure Anderson Shelter, we were proud of.
We also had a challenge to diffuse a bomb (balloon). In pairs, we were given our bomb (a balloon filled with water and wrapped in wool), we had to try and take the wool off carefully using two pencils without the bomb exploding (balloon popping). It was more challenging than we thought.
